Loading system/bta/le_audio/codec_manager.cc +1 −2 Original line number Diff line number Diff line Loading @@ -128,8 +128,7 @@ struct codec_manager_impl { CodecLocation GetCodecLocation(void) const { return codec_location_; } bool IsOffloadDualBiDirSwbSupported(void) const { return codec_location_ == le_audio::types::CodecLocation::ADSP && offload_dual_bidirection_swb_supported_; return offload_dual_bidirection_swb_supported_; } void UpdateActiveAudioConfig( Loading system/bta/le_audio/devices.cc +3 −1 Original line number Diff line number Diff line Loading @@ -1426,7 +1426,9 @@ bool LeAudioDeviceGroup::IsAudioSetConfigurationSupported( AudioSetConfigurationProvider::Get()->CheckConfigurationIsBiDirSwb( *audio_set_conf)) { if (!dual_bidirection_swb_supported_ || !CodecManager::GetInstance()->IsOffloadDualBiDirSwbSupported()) { (CodecManager::GetInstance()->GetCodecLocation() == types::CodecLocation::ADSP && !CodecManager::GetInstance()->IsOffloadDualBiDirSwbSupported())) { /* two conditions * 1) dual bidirection swb is not supported for both software/offload * 2) offload not supported Loading system/bta/le_audio/le_audio_set_configuration_provider_json.cc +2 −2 Original line number Diff line number Diff line Loading @@ -773,8 +773,8 @@ bool AudioSetConfigurationProvider::CheckConfigurationIsBiDirSwb( bool AudioSetConfigurationProvider::CheckConfigurationIsDualBiDirSwb( const set_configurations::AudioSetConfiguration& set_configuration) const { bool single_dev_dual_bidir_swb = false; bool dual_dev_dual_bidir_swb = false; uint8_t single_dev_dual_bidir_swb = 0; uint8_t dual_dev_dual_bidir_swb = 0; for (const auto& conf : set_configuration.confs) { if (conf.codec.GetConfigSamplingFrequency() < Loading Loading
system/bta/le_audio/codec_manager.cc +1 −2 Original line number Diff line number Diff line Loading @@ -128,8 +128,7 @@ struct codec_manager_impl { CodecLocation GetCodecLocation(void) const { return codec_location_; } bool IsOffloadDualBiDirSwbSupported(void) const { return codec_location_ == le_audio::types::CodecLocation::ADSP && offload_dual_bidirection_swb_supported_; return offload_dual_bidirection_swb_supported_; } void UpdateActiveAudioConfig( Loading
system/bta/le_audio/devices.cc +3 −1 Original line number Diff line number Diff line Loading @@ -1426,7 +1426,9 @@ bool LeAudioDeviceGroup::IsAudioSetConfigurationSupported( AudioSetConfigurationProvider::Get()->CheckConfigurationIsBiDirSwb( *audio_set_conf)) { if (!dual_bidirection_swb_supported_ || !CodecManager::GetInstance()->IsOffloadDualBiDirSwbSupported()) { (CodecManager::GetInstance()->GetCodecLocation() == types::CodecLocation::ADSP && !CodecManager::GetInstance()->IsOffloadDualBiDirSwbSupported())) { /* two conditions * 1) dual bidirection swb is not supported for both software/offload * 2) offload not supported Loading
system/bta/le_audio/le_audio_set_configuration_provider_json.cc +2 −2 Original line number Diff line number Diff line Loading @@ -773,8 +773,8 @@ bool AudioSetConfigurationProvider::CheckConfigurationIsBiDirSwb( bool AudioSetConfigurationProvider::CheckConfigurationIsDualBiDirSwb( const set_configurations::AudioSetConfiguration& set_configuration) const { bool single_dev_dual_bidir_swb = false; bool dual_dev_dual_bidir_swb = false; uint8_t single_dev_dual_bidir_swb = 0; uint8_t dual_dev_dual_bidir_swb = 0; for (const auto& conf : set_configuration.confs) { if (conf.codec.GetConfigSamplingFrequency() < Loading